Louisiana Baseball Preview: at Dallas Baptist

3/5/2026 8:14:00 PM | Baseball

Ragin' Cajuns have won 10 of last 11 games entering final non-con weekend series

LAFAYETTE – The Louisiana Ragin' Cajuns baseball team closes out its final nonconference weekend of the regular season when it travels to face Dallas Baptist in a three-game series beginning Friday at Joan and Andy Horner Ballpark.
 
First pitch for Friday's opener is scheduled for 6:30 p.m. The series continues Saturday at 3 p.m. before concluding Sunday at 1 p.m. All three games will be streamed on ESPN+, while fans can listen locally on KPEL-FM (96.5) and worldwide through the Varsity Network app.
 
Louisiana (10-3), winners of 10 of its last 11 games, claimed its past two weekend series with a three-game sweep of Maryland before taking two of three last weekend against UC San Diego. The Ragin' Cajuns also earned a midweek victory over No. 2 LSU on Wednesday as Cody Brasch picked up his first win in a Louisiana uniform and freshman Sawyer Pruitt recorded his first career save.
 
A trio of newcomers has paced the Cajuns offensively this season. Colt Brown is hitting .347 with six RBI, while Rigoberto Hernandez is batting .317 with two home runs and eight RBI. Blaze Rodriguez has added a .283 average with eight RBI. Maddox Mandino enters the weekend leading the team with nine RBI while batting .277.
 
Lee Amedee (.277-1-8) recorded two hits, including an RBI double, in Wednesday's win over LSU, while Drew Markle (.261-2-8) is tied for the team lead with two home runs.
 
Southpaw Andrew Herrmann (2-0, 1.33 ERA) is scheduled to start Friday's opener for Louisiana. Junior right-hander JR Tollett (2-0, 5.82 ERA) will take the mound on Saturday, while Sunday's starter has yet to be announced.
 
Dallas Baptist (8-5) was shut out for the first time this season Tuesday in a 2-0 loss at No. 10 Oklahoma. The Patriots opened the season with four straight victories before dropping a three-game series at UTSA from Feb. 20-22. DBU went 3-1 last week, taking two games from Air Force while splitting a pair against Oral Roberts.
 
Ben Tryon leads the Patriots at the plate with a .367 average, plus three home runs and 11 RBI. Cooper Neville is hitting .361 with three home runs and 14 RBI, while Adam Berghult is batting .353 with two home runs and nine RBI. As a team, DBU is hitting .301 with 21 home runs and 24 stolen bases.
 
Dallas Baptist is expected to start a trio of right-handers during the series. Russ Smith (1-1, 10.80 ERA) will start Friday, followed by Jared Schaeffer (2-0, 4.05 ERA) on Saturday and Ryan Borberg (0-1, 8.10 ERA) in Sunday's finale.
 
Louisiana has won six of the eight meetings in the all-time series, with all previous matchups played in Lafayette. Dallas Baptist took two of three games in last year's series at Russo Park.
